Timezone in Tiszasüly
Tiszasüly is located in the Europe/Budapest timezone, which operates at a UTC offset of +1 hour during standard time. When daylight saving time is observed, the offset changes to UTC +2 hours. Daylight saving time in Tiszasüly begins on the last Sunday in March and ends on the last Sunday in October, meaning clocks are set forward one hour in spring and set back one hour in autumn.
When compared to the United States, Tiszasüly is typically ahead of Eastern Standard Time (UTC -5) by six hours, and ahead of Pacific Standard Time (UTC -8) by nine hours. Attractions and Activities in Tiszasüly
Tiszasüly is a small village in Hungary, located in the Jász-Nagykun-Szolnok County, known for its tranquil rural environment and proximity to the Tisza River. This area is characterized by its agricultural landscape, traditional Hungarian countryside, and a slower pace of life. The village reflects the charm of rural Hungary, where visitors can experience the local way of life and enjoy the natural beauty of the surrounding landscapes.
While Tiszasüly itself may not be a hub of famous attractions, its location offers access to the nearby Tisza River, which is popular for recreational activities such as fishing, canoeing, and birdwatching. The region is also known for its rich flora and fauna, making it a great spot for nature enthusiasts.
